Transaction 17cfa4524be46809095f3243e69627dff88f5251523981964868e3de32e10873
1 Input
1 Output
-
17cfa4524be46809095f3243e69627dff88f5251523981964868e3de32e10873:0
- value
- 513967
- script pubkey
- OP_0 OP_PUSHBYTES_20 6aed6565987f864f8ab71426a8ee0194f040c921
- address
- bc1qdtkk2evc07rylz4hzsn23mspjncypjfpzz7qhm